Varuhuset PUB / PUB Department Store

Inscription.   Ursprungligen manufakturaffär, grundad av Paul U Bergström 1882. Byggt 1917-37. Huset vid Kungsgatan tillkom 1917, fasad Cyrillus Johansson, byggnaden mot Hötorget 1925, arkitekter E Bernhard och H Ahlberg. Husen mot Drottninggatan sammanbyggdes 1937, ark. A von Schmalensee. Bohagshuset vid Drottninggatan byggdes 1955-59, arkitekter Erik och Tore Ahlsén. Efter Paul U Bergströms död 1934 övertogs varuhuset av Konsum. Drivs sedan 1994 som entrepenörsvaruhus.

The present store premises were erected between 1917 and 1937 with the addition of the notable building south of Drottninggatan in 1959. The complex reopened after alterations in 1994.

[English translation of Swedish text:]
Originally a goods shop, founded by Paul U. Bergström in 1882. Built in 1917-37. The building on Kungsgatan was built in 1917, with a facade designed by Cyrillus Johansson; the building opposite Hötorget Square was built in 1925, architects E. Bernhard and H. Ahlberg. The buildings on Drottninggatan were built in 1937, architect A. von Schmalensee. The household goods store on Drottninggatan was built 1955-59, architects

Erik and Tore Ahlsén. After Paul U. Bergström's death in 1934, the department store was taken over by Konsum. Since 1994 has been run as a shopping mall.
 
Erected 2000 by Samfundet S:t Erik.
